Old pathways lost under a blanket of freshly fallen snow make way for new tracks on trails yet to be made. Powder Tracks Winter Ale, a malt forward beer with chocolate and caramel notes touched with a hint of citrus aroma, will call you to forget the noise and embrace the quiet of a winter trail.

Medium amber and bright. Medium head. Biscuity malt nose, light herbaceous hop. Mild fruitiness of yeast. A touch of crystal malt, moderate bitterness, slight marmaladey note. A very stoupaceous take on the winter ale, I like it.

On tap at Stoup, pours a clear dark amber with a small beige head. Aroma brings out rich resinous hops, toasted caramel, and bready malt. Flavour is rich and resinous, with lots of resinous and piney hops, and a chewy toasted caramel malt. Wonderful resinous hop character. Excellent.
